Regulatory Frameworks and Licensing in Canada
Canada’s approach to online gambling is characterized by provincial regulation, with each jurisdiction setting its own rules and licensing requirements. Notably, the Ontario Gaming Control Commission has established a comprehensive licensing regime, which includes stringent standards for fairness, security, and player protection. Licensed operators undergo rigorous vetting, and their platforms are subjected to ongoing audits to ensure compliance.
Security and Trust: Foundations of Credibility
Given the proliferation of online gambling sites, establishing trust is paramount. Players increasingly demand transparency, fair play, and reliable customer service. Encryption protocols like SSL, identity verification processes, and adherence to anti-money laundering policies exemplify industry best practices. For Canadian players, assurance of regulatory compliance effectively safeguards their gaming experience.
Technological Innovations Shaping User Engagement
The integration of emerging technologies such as artificial intelligence (AI), virtual reality (VR), and blockchain are revolutionizing online casinos. AI enables personalized recommendations, responsible gaming tools, and fraud detection, while VR creates immersive environments that rival land-based casinos. Blockchain ensures transparency and provokes shifts towards decentralized betting, further enhancing trust.
